MERLIN, Ore. (AP) — Authorities in southwestern Oregon say a preliminary investigation has determined that a 15-year-old boy handling a firearm died after accidentally shooting himself. Oregon State Police in a statement Monday say emergency crews responded at about 8:30 p.m. Saturday to a residence near Merlin where they found the boy dead.

EUGENE, Ore. (AP) — The Eugene Airport has completed a $19 million renovation project intended to reduce the time it takes travelers to get through security. The Register-Guard reports in a story on Monday that the renovation included moving the passenger screening station from the center of the terminal lobby.

MYRTLE CREEK, Ore. (AP) — Oregon State Police say two women have died after apparently falling from a bridge on Interstate 5 following a single-vehicle crash. Police say emergency crews responded at about 2:30 a.m.

KENO, Ore. (AP) — Authorities in southwestern Oregon say they’ve taken a juvenile male into custody following the stabbing death of a 74-year-old woman. The Klamath County district attorney’s office says police responded to a reported stabbing in Keno on Saturday morning and found Judith Anne Rose dead at the scene.
